Let Us Not Condemn School Drop Outs-GENET

Girls Empowerment Network (GENET) says girls who dropped out of school are more vulnerable and they are at risk of being sexually abused because of poverty comparing to those in school.

GENET Programs Coordinator Biata Banda said this on Friday in Luchenza at the end of a three-day summer girls camp which attracted at least 100 out of school girls from all the nine Traditional Authorities in Mulanje district.

She said most projects target in school girls and those who dropped out of school are oftentimes ignored and they feel condemned.

Banda said such situations put them at the risk of being sexually abused.

"It is therefore very important to equip these girls with business and Sexual and Reproductive Health knowledge and the past three days we oriented them on gender and gender based violence, SRHR, HIV and AIDS and small-scale business management," said Banda.

She said girls who want to go back to school they should do so and those who do not have opportunity of going back to school they can start small scale businesses and become economically independent.

One of the role models during the girls’ camp was a 23 year old Georgina Banda.

She is a tailor and makes bungles and earrings and she urged fellow girls to have goals and work hard to achieve them.

'Let us accept that girls face a lot of challenges at school, in their families and in their communities but with determination and self-esteem, we can overcome these problems and become economically independent one day," said Georgina a mother of one.

One of the girls who attended the camp, Shammim Naperi from Safari village in T/A Njema thanked GENET for organizing the camp, saying the lessons learnt will transform her life.   

GENET is implementing Adolescent Girls and Young Women (AGYW) project in Mulanje district with funding from the Global Fund through World Vision Malawi.
